Understanding Cannabis Vape Devices
What are the different types of vape devices?
Cannabis vape devices vary in design and function. The most common types include:
- Portable vaporizers – Compact, battery-powered, and ideal for on-the-go use.
- Desktop vaporizers – Larger, powerful devices designed for home sessions.
- Vape pens – Slim and discreet, perfect for beginners or micro-dosing.
Key components of a vape device
Regardless of style, most vape devices include:
- Heating element – Vaporizes cannabis oil or flower.
- Chamber or tank – Holds cannabis concentrates, oils, or dry flowers.
- Mouthpiece – The part from which vapor is inhaled.
Understanding these parts is the first step toward proper maintenance.
Why Cleaning and Maintenance Matter
Effects of residue buildup
- Flavor changes: Resin buildup alters taste, leading to burnt or bitter vapor.
- Device performance: Blocked airflow reduces vapor production and stresses components.
Health considerations
- Dirty devices can harbor bacteria and mold.
- Regular cleaning reduces exposure to harmful byproducts left behind by burnt residue.
Keeping your vape clean isn’t just about performance, it’s about protecting your health.
Step-by-Step Guide to Cleaning a Cannabis Vape
How often should you clean?
- Light users: Every 5–7 sessions.
- Frequent users: Every 2–3 sessions.
- Warning signs: Harsh taste, sticky residue, or weak vapor output.
Essential cleaning tools
- Isopropyl alcohol (90% or higher)
- Cotton swabs or Q-tips
- Small brushes
- Microfiber cloth
Cleaning process
- Disassemble the device carefully.
- Check manufacturer guidelines to avoid damage.
- Clean the heating chamber with a cotton swab dipped in alcohol.
- Wash the mouthpiece with warm, soapy water and rinse thoroughly.
- Wipe tanks or chambers gently to remove buildup.
- Allow components to dry fully before reassembling.
- Run a burn-off cycle (heat the device empty) to clear any leftover alcohol.
Deep cleaning methods
For heavy buildup:
- Soak removable parts in isopropyl alcohol overnight.
- Use an ultrasonic cleaner for professional-grade results.
Pro Maintenance Tips for Longevity
Proper storage practices
- Store your vape in a cool, dry place.
- Avoid leaving devices in direct sunlight or humid environments.
Periodic checks
- Inspect batteries regularly for swelling or damage.
- Monitor tanks and mouthpieces for cracks or leaks.
When to replace parts
- Heating element: Replace if vapor output declines.
- Mouthpiece: Swap out if cracked or excessively dirty.
- Tanks: Change when buildup becomes unmanageable.
Always buy replacement parts from reputable suppliers to ensure safety and compatibility.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q1: How often should I clean my cannabis vape device?
Light users should clean every 5–7 sessions, while frequent users benefit from cleaning every 2–3 sessions.
Q2: Can I clean my vape with just water?
Water works for mouthpieces, but isopropyl alcohol is best for chambers and tanks.
Q3: What happens if I skip cleaning?
Skipping maintenance can cause burnt flavors, weak vapor, bacteria buildup, and even device failure.
Q4: Do all parts of a vape need cleaning?
Yes. Chambers, tanks, and mouthpieces need regular cleaning. Batteries should be wiped but never soaked.
Q5: Does cleaning extend my vape’s lifespan?
Yes. Routine cleaning reduces wear and prevents early part replacements.
